"Method of Disposition waived by magistrate" refers to a legal situation where a magistrate allows a defendant to bypass the usual procedures for handling a case, such as a preliminary hearing or specific motions. This waiver can expedite the legal process, enabling the case to move forward without the standard procedural requirements. It typically occurs when both parties agree to the waiver or when the magistrate deems it appropriate for the circumstances of the case.
